There is no most correct treatment for premature ejaculation in the elderly, but rather the appropriate method should be chosen according to their own situation. Commonly used methods include medication, psychotherapy, behavioral therapy, surgical treatment and so on.
1. Medication: Selective 5-hydroxytryptamine reuptake inhibitors such as sertraline and paroxetine can be used. If premature ejaculation is caused by the sensitivity of the penis head, local anesthetics such as lidocaine and oxybutynin can be used for local application. Thus prolonging the ejaculation time. All the above drugs need to pay attention to the side effects and adverse reactions of drugs, please use the above drugs under the guidance of a doctor.
2. Psychological factors: analyze the psychological barriers of patients with premature ejaculation, analyze and enlighten their psychological barriers, and eliminate patients’ nervousness and anxiety during sex.
3. Behavioral treatment: commonly used behavioral treatments include the squeeze method and the stop-action method, which can be gradually and progressively trained for the treatment.
4. Behavioral treatment: when the above treatment is not effective, surgical treatment can be considered, mainly referring to the selective cut-off of the dorsal penile nerve.
